苏云金芽孢杆菌不同亚种菌株制剂毒力效价的研究

摘    要:采用苏云金芽孢杆菌制剂美国标准品:Bacillus thuringiensis subsp. Kurstaki HD-1-S-1980(H_(3a3b))对不同亚种制剂:Bacillus thuringiensis subsp. Dendrolimus U菌株(H_(4a4b))和Bacillus thuringiensis subsp. Galleriae C88菌株(H_5a5b))进行了毒力效价的研究。以U菌株制备的标样与美国标准品对不同试虫进行了比较。生物测定的结果表明,U菌株标样的效价分别为18666.6IU/mg(试虫为马尾松毛虫Dendrolimus punctatus 2龄幼虫)、22956.5IU/mg(试虫为小菜蛾Plutella xylostella 2龄幼虫),均高于美国标样16000IU/mg的水平。其敏感度为小菜蛾大于马尾松毛虫。以U菌株和C88菌株生产的中试产品用美国标准品进行毒力测定,试虫为马尾松毛虫,其结果表明,U菌株产品毒力效价为36444.4IU/mg;C88菌株产品为28521.7IU/mg,两者均明显高于美国标准品。试验结果还表明,采用美国标准品及马尾松毛虫和小菜蛾为…

STUDY ON THE TEST AND EVALUATION OF THE TOXICITY OF THE STRAINS PREPARATION OF THE DIFFERENT SUBSPECIES OF BACILLUS THURINGIENS1S AND ON THE RESEARCH INTO ITS STANDARDIZATION

Abstract:In this paper using the preparation of Bacillus thuringiensis of USA standard sample-subsp. kurstaki HD-l-S-1980 (H3a3b) the toxicity to different subspecies preparations such as subsp. dendrolimus U strain(H4a4b), subsp. galleriae C88 strain (H5a5b) is tested and evaluated. And product's standardization is also researched. Comparing their toxicity to various test-insects between the standard sample prepared from U strain and USA, stamdard sample, the boilogical determined results are as follws: the toxicity of U strain standard sample is respectively 18666.6IU/mg(test-insects: Dendrolimus punctatus, 2nd larva), 22956.5IU/mg(test-insects: Plutella kylostella, 2nd larva). The above-mentioned toxicity evaluations are higher than that of 16000 IU / mg of USA standard sample. The comparison in susceptibility shows as follows: suscepticibility of plutella kylostella is stronger than that of Dendrolimus punctatus. The products from U strain and C88 strain are trial-produced in medium-scale. The product's toxicity to test-insect Dendrolimus punctatus is determined using USA standard sample. The results are obtained as follows the toxicity evaluation of U strain products is 36444.4 IU / mg; that of C88 strain products is 28521.7 IU / mg. The both are obviously higher than that of USA standard sample. This proves that different subspecies strain's toxicity to the same test-insect is with defference and it is an important way to raise product's toxicity by improving and optimizing process in production. The whole experiment shows it is feasible to rectify the evaluation of the toxicity of our country's present products using USA standard sample, Dendrolimus punctatus and Plutella kylostella as test-insets. And it is simple and convienient as well as save time and save effort to make statistical analysis in computer with Basic program. To do statistical and operational analysis using our designed basic, programming by micro-computer is more accurate and repid than by caculator.
